简体中文简体中文
EnglishEnglish
简体中文简体中文

PHP简易源码:入门级开发者必备的代码模板

2025-01-24 15:46:45

随着互联网技术的不断发展,PHP作为一种流行的服务器端脚本语言,被广泛应用于各种Web开发项目中。对于初学者来说,掌握PHP的基础语法和常用功能是至关重要的。本文将为大家介绍一些PHP简易源码,帮助入门级开发者快速入门,提高编程能力。

一、PHP简易源码概述

PHP简易源码是指一些简单、实用的PHP代码片段,它们通常包含一个或多个功能,可以快速实现特定的需求。这些源码对于新手来说,不仅可以作为学习参考,还可以在实际项目中直接应用,提高开发效率。

二、PHP简易源码示例

以下是一些常见的PHP简易源码示例,供大家参考:

1.数据库连接

`php <?php $servername = "localhost"; $username = "username"; $password = "password"; $dbname = "myDB";

// 创建连接 $conn = new mysqli($servername, $username, $password, $dbname);

// 检测连接 if ($conn->connecterror) { die("连接失败: " . $conn->connecterror); } ?> `

2.数据插入

`php <?php $sql = "INSERT INTO table_name (column1, column2, column3) VALUES ('value1', 'value2', 'value3')";

if ($conn->query($sql) === TRUE) { echo "新记录插入成功"; } else { echo "Error: " . $sql . "<br>" . $conn->error; } ?> `

3.数据查询

`php <?php $sql = "SELECT column1, column2, column3 FROM table_name"; $result = $conn->query($sql);

if ($result->numrows > 0) { // 输出数据 while($row = $result->fetchassoc()) { echo "column1: " . $row["column1"]. " - column2: " . $row["column2"]. " - column3: " . $row["column3"]. "<br>"; } } else { echo "0 结果"; } ?> `

4.数据更新

`php <?php $sql = "UPDATE table_name SET column1='value1', column2='value2' WHERE column3='value3'";

if ($conn->query($sql) === TRUE) { echo "记录更新成功"; } else { echo "Error: " . $sql . "<br>" . $conn->error; } ?> `

5.数据删除

`php <?php $sql = "DELETE FROM table_name WHERE column1='value1'";

if ($conn->query($sql) === TRUE) { echo "记录删除成功"; } else { echo "Error: " . $sql . "<br>" . $conn->error; } ?> `

6.验证用户名和密码

`php <?php $username = $POST['username']; $password = $POST['password'];

// 连接数据库 $conn = new mysqli($servername, $username, $password, $dbname);

// 检测连接 if ($conn->connecterror) { die("连接失败: " . $conn->connecterror); }

// 查询数据库 $sql = "SELECT * FROM users WHERE username='$username' AND password='$password'"; $result = $conn->query($sql);

if ($result->num_rows > 0) { echo "登录成功"; } else { echo "用户名或密码错误"; }

$conn->close(); ?> `

三、总结

通过以上PHP简易源码示例,我们可以看到PHP在实际开发中的应用非常广泛。这些源码可以帮助入门级开发者快速掌握PHP的基本语法和常用功能,提高编程能力。在实际项目中,我们可以根据需求对这些源码进行修改和扩展,以满足不同的业务需求。

总之,学习PHP简易源码是提高PHP编程水平的重要途径。希望本文对大家有所帮助,祝愿大家在PHP编程的道路上越走越远!